The victim of a fatal Tuesday night shooting has been identified.
Lamaceo Smith, 22, of Columbus was found lying in the roadway near the Columbus Heights apartments, Lowndes County Coroner Greg Merchant confirmed.
An autopsy has been ordered, and the body will be sent to the state medical examiner’s office, Merchant said.
Sheriff Eddie Hawkins said that Smith was found soon after 911 received a call regarding shots fired at about 7:35 p.m.
Smith had a gunshot wound to the chest, Hawkins said, and was pronounced dead at the scene.
No one has been arrested in the incident.
